1. Open a high resolution photograph of a person's face in Photoshop.

 

big-mouth-strikes-again01.jpg

 

2. Goto Layer > Duplicate Layer... and click OK when the Duplicate Layer pop-up appears.

3. Turn off the visibility of the bottom layer by clicking the "Eye" icon for that layer in the Layers Palette.

 

big-mouth-strikes-again02.gif

 

4. With the new duplicate layer selected, select the eraser tool and erase everything except the mouth and some of the skin that surrounds the mouth.

 

big-mouth-strikes-again03.jpg

 

5. Turn on the visibility of the bottom layer by clicking the "Eye" icon in the Layers Palette.

 

big-mouth-strikes-again02.gif

 

6. With the bottom layer active, click CTRL+T to enter into Free Transform mode.

7. Use a corner shape handle while holding down the shift key and drag to shrink the image.

 

big-mouth-strikes-again04.jpg

 

8. Select the layer with the mouth and move it over the area where the mouth should be.

9. Goto Layer > Flatten Image to merge all the layers.

10. Select the Smudge Tool and choose an appropriate sized brush.

11. Carefully smudge around the mouth so that it blends with the face.

12. You're done! Your image should be a little smaller than the one you started out with, due to the resizing in Step 7.
